Sony STR-DH500 A/V Receiver
The Sony STR-DH500 5.1 Channel A/V Receiver features HDMI™ “Pass-through” and 1080/24p capability thus making it compatible with the latest HD sources (i.e. Blu-ray Disc™ Players, the PlayStation™ 3, etc…). The Sony STR-DH500 A/V Receiver HD features 5 HD inputs providing ample connection options at an inexpensive price. The Sony STR-DH500 has a DIGITAL MEDIA PORT input expanding the flexibility to playback music from various audio sources (i.e. iPod®, Walkman, Bluetooth device or PC) with one of the various accessories (sold separately)

Specifications:

Audio

  • A/V Sync : Yes (fixed)
  • Bravia_Sync : Yes
  • Channel Power Rating : 5.1 Channel Power Rating: 100W x 5 Amp Power (8 ohms, THD 1.0%)
  • DSP : Sharc
  • Equalizer : BASS and Treble control
  • Impedance : 8 Ohms
  • Sound Fields : Cinema StudioEX. A/B/C; 3 Movie; 4 Music; 5 A.F.D.; 2 2 Channel;2 Headphone; Portable Audio Enhancer
  • Sub Woofer Crossover : 13 Point (40-160Hz)
  • Tuner Type : Auto Tuning, Direct Tuning, Station Name

Audio Features
  • 96k/24Bit PCM : Yes
  • Cinema Studio EX. A/B/C mode : Yes
  • Digital Cinema Sound™ Technology : Yes
  • Dolby® Digital Decoding : Yes
  • Dolby® Digital Dual Mono : Yes
  • Dolby® Pro Logic® Decoding : Yes
  • Dolby® Pro Logic® II Decoding : Yes
  • dts® Decoding : Yes
Convenience
  • AM/FM Memory Presets : 30 FM - 30 AM
  • Auto Tuning : Yes
  • Direct Tuning : Yes (Remote)
  • Preset Memory : 90 (30 Sirius, 30 FM, 30 AM)2
  • Sleep Timer : Yes
  • Station Name Display : Yes
Hardware
  • Remote Control : Yes, RM-AAU020
Inputs and Outputs
  • Antenna Terminal (AM Loop) : 1 (Rear)
  • Antenna Terminal (FM 75 Ohm) : 1 (Rear)
  • Coaxial Audio Digital Input(s) : 1 (Rear)
  • Component Video (Y/Pb/Pr) Input(s) : 3 (Rear)
  • Component Video (Y/Pb/Pr) Output(s) : 1 (Rear)
  • Composite Video Input(s) : 2 (1 Front/1 Rear)
  • Composite Video Output(s) : 1 (Rear)
  • Digital Media Port : 1 (Rear)
  • HD Component Video Input(s) : 2 (Rear)- pass through
  • HD Component Video Output(s) : 1 (Rear)
  • HDMI™ Connection Input(s) : 3 (Rear)- switcher
  • HDMI™ Connection Output(s) : 1 (Rear)
  • Headphone Output(s) : 1 (Front- Gold)
  • Optical Audio Input(s) : 2 (Rear)
  • RCA Audio Input(s) : 4 (2 Dedicated Audio/2 Audio/Video)
  • Subwoofer Output(s) : 1 (Rear)- 13 point Crossover (40-160Hz)
Power
  • Power Consumption (in Operation)_new : 120V 60Hz
  • Power Consumption (in Standby) : 0.3W
  • Power Requirements : 120V 60Hz
Speaker
  • Speaker Terminal Type : Front: Banana, Rear and Center: Push
Weights and Measurements
  • Dimensions (Approx.) : 17 x 6.25 x 12.75" (430 x 157.5 x 322mm)
  • Weight (Approx.) : 16.41 lbs (7.4Kg)


Detailed Features

A Closer Look:

Features

  • 5 HD Inputs compatible with HD video : The STR-DH500 has ample HD connections compatible with various HD signals. Being the central hub of your audio and video sources, the STR-DH500 ensures seamless compatibility with today’s demanding HD sources.
  • HD Film Quality with 24p TRUE CINEMA : Most of all Hollywood movies are shot at 24 frames per second, and Blu-ray Disc™ movies are mastered at 24 frame per second, so it is only fitting that the STR-DH500can output your films at 1080/24p for a true film-like experience at home.
  • Multi Function Audio Input : Sony’s DIGITAL MEDIA PORT plays back music from various audio sources whether it is stored on an iPod, Walkman, Bluetooth device or PC.
  • Quick Speaker Set Up : An ideal listening experience is only a button away. Simply place the included microphone in your listening position, push a single button and speaker placement, distance and delays are automatically adjusted.

An affordable upgrade for an old receiver
Reviewer:  Darkemans on  Aug 27, 2009
Customer Rating:    4.8
Value 5.0
Features 4.0
Quality 5.0
Performance 5.0

My 10yr-old Pioneer 300w receiver still worked pretty well, except the dead remote that controlled half the functions, but it lacked modern connections. I wanted component, optical, coaxial and HDMI inputs, and I got all that plus 200w more power. The only thing I wish this receiver had is 1080p upconversion, but since receivers that have it are way more expensive, I can live without it. I upgraded my speakers (except my powered sub) at the same time, and my system sounds great to me.

A Sony innovation, 10 years in the making
Every once in a while, a new technology emerges that changes everything. At just 3mm thin, Sony has developed an unbelievably thin TV - while advancing image quality to levels that no other TV can match. This technology is called OLED.

Organic Light Emitting Diode, or OLED, is a technology that uses carbon-based organic material in a process that converts electric energy into light. This light is used to illuminate the screen and produce the most astounding results ever seen on a television. OLED emits light and does not require a backlight-realizing a new TV form of approximately 3mm at its thinnest point. And when these elements are in their "off" state, they consume no power. The result? OLED TVs use less energy than LCDs. The OLED display consumes less electricity compared to conventional displays because OLED's light-emitting structure does not require a separate light source and can be powered using very low voltages.

Meeting the RoHS Directive
All Sony VAIO computers have PVC-free exterior product casings and packaging. They are also EU Restriction of Hazardous Substances (RoHS) Directive compliant. The RoHS directive restricts the amount of certain materials such as lead and mercury, used in electronic products. By limiting the use of hazardous substances, RoHS aims not only to help prevent harmful materials from leaching into our ecosystems but also helps minimize potential exposure to these substances and promotes easier recycling at the end of a product's lifecycle.

 Sony adopted the use of recycled and reused materials in several models of our LCDs, and all are EU Restriction of Hazardous Substances (RoHS) Directive compliant, helping prevent harmful materials, such as lead, from leaching into our ecosystem when improperly disposed while also helping increase recycling and reduce potential chemical exposure from the manufacturing process. And further keeping green in mind, suppliers for products are certified as green partners based on Sony's stringent standard for chemical substances used in products.

All Sony® Blu-ray Disc™ Player parts, and all other Sony products, are lead and cadmium-free, based on EU RoHS directive restrictions, and major plastic parts of the Blu-ray Disc Player are free of brominated flame retardants.

 Sony Ericsson is the first company to remove brominated flame retardants from its mobile phones and the first to manufacture a full range of products, including accessories, which are also brominated flame retardant free.

They were also the first in ensuring that every device in their range was fully compliant with the EU Directive on the restriction of hazardous substances (RoHS). Sony Ericsson phones are PVC free, and we are currently working to phase out antimony, beryllium and phthalates from our products.
